How to Install JAVA 8 on RHEL

Step 1 – Download Latest Java Archive



Sudo -i


Sudo yum install wget


JAVA DOWNLOAD

link in The description


tar xzf jdk-8u202-linux-x64.tar.gz


Step 1.1 – Install Java 8 with Alter


/opt/jdk1.8.0_202

alternatives --install /usr/bin/java java /opt/jdk1.8.0_202/bin/java 2

alternatives --config java


alternatives --install /usr/bin/jar jar /opt/jdk1.8.0_202/bin/jar 2

alternatives --install /usr/bin/javac javac /opt/jdk1.8.0_202/bin/javac 2

alternatives --set jar /opt/jdk1.8.0_202/bin/jar

alternatives --set javac /opt/jdk1.8.0_202/bin/javac


Step 1.2 – Check Installed Java V

java -version


Step 1.3 – Setup Java Environment Variables



export JAVA_HOME=/opt/jdk1.8.0_202/
export JRE_HOME=/opt/jdk1.8.0_202/jre
export PATH=$PATH:/opt/jdk1.8.0_202/bin/jdk1.8.0_202/jre/bin


vi /etc/bashrc
export JAVA_HOME=/opt/jdk1.8.0_202/
export JRE_HOME=/opt/jdk1.8.0_202/jre
export PATH=$PATH:/opt/jdk1.8.0_202/bin/jdk1.8.0_202/jre/bin


Step 2: Creating Hadoop



adduser hadoop
passwd hadoop


su - hadoop
ssh-keygen -t rsa
cat ~/.ssh/id_rsa.pub >> ~/.ssh/authorized_keys
chmod 0600 ~/.ssh/authorized_keys


ssh localhost
exit


Step 3. Downloading Hadoop

cd ~



tar xzf hadoop-2.6.5.tar.gz


mv hadoop-2.6.5 hadoop


Step 4. Configure Hadoop Pseudo-Distributed 

Mode


Vi ~/.bashrc
export HADOOP_HOME=/home/hadoop/hadoop
export HADOOP_INSTALL=$HADOOP_HOME
export HADOOP_MAPRED_HOME=$HADOOP_HOME
export HADOOP_COMMON_HOME=$HADOOP_HOME
export HADOOP_HDFS_HOME=$HADOOP_HOME
export YARN_HOME=$HADOOP_HOME
export HADOOP_COMMON_LIB_NATIVE_DIR=$HADOOP_HOME/lib/native
export PATH=$PATH:$HADOOP_HOME/sbin:$HADOOP_HOME/bin
source ~/.bashrc
Now edit $HADOOP_HOME/etc/hadoop/hadoop-env.sh file and set  
 JAVA_HOME environment variable.
Change the JAVA path as per install on your syste


export JAVA_HOME=/opt/jdk1.8.0_202/
cd $HADOOP_HOME/etc/hadoop


vi core-site.xml

<property>
<name>fs.default.name</name>
<value>hdfs://localhost:9000</value>
</property>


vi hdfs-site.xml

<property>
<name>dfs.replication</name>
<value>1</value>
</property>
<property>
 <name>dfs.name.dir</name>
   <value>file:///home/hadoop/hadoopdata/hdfs/namenode</value>
</property>
<property>
 <name>dfs.data.dir</name>
   <value>file:///home/hadoop/hadoopdata/hdfs/datanode</value>
</property>


Edit mapred-site.xml


<property>
 <name>mapreduce.framework.name</name>
  <value>yarn</value>
</property>


Edit yarn-site.xml


<property>
 <name>yarn.nodemanager.aux-services</name>
   <value>mapreduce_shuffle</value>
</property>



4.3. Format Namenode


hdfs namenode -format

Step 5. Start Hadoop Cluster

cd $HADOOP_HOME/sbin/

start-dfs.sh

start-yarn.sh
